Technical Field
[0001] This invention relates to the field of detection technology, and more particularly to a method and apparatus for analyzing the height of material surface in a slag flushing pool. Background Technology
[0002] This section is intended to provide background or context for the embodiments of the invention set forth in the claims. The description herein is not an admission that it is prior art simply because it is included in this section.
[0003] A slag flushing tank is a bucket-shaped concrete structure, wider at the top and narrower at the bottom, used to collect blast furnace slag. In the metallurgical industry, blast furnace smelting produces a large amount of slag. After being granulated by high-speed water quenching, the slag enters the slag flushing tank. The large amount of slag settling at the bottom of the tank can easily lead to poor water permeability, affecting the operation of related pumps and even disrupting normal blast furnace production. Simultaneously, the water-quenched slag is a high-quality cement raw material. Therefore, in actual production, the slag needs to be continuously removed from the slag flushing tank, and overhead cranes are one of the most important slag removal devices. The overhead crane system uses grab buckets to grab slag at any position in the slag flushing tank. Currently, the method of grabbing slag is inefficient and requires many grabs, increasing the energy consumption of the overhead crane and thus resulting in poor economic performance. Summary of the Invention
[0004] This invention provides a method for analyzing the material level in a slag flushing tank. This method improves slag handling efficiency and economic efficiency, and includes:
[0005] Obtain three-dimensional point cloud data of the slag flushing pool surface;
[0006] Determine the grabbing range of the grab bucket in the slag flushing pool based on the size parameters of the grab bucket;
[0007] Based on the size parameters of the grab bucket and the three-dimensional point cloud data of each material surface within the grab range, multiple cubes are determined; each cube contains multiple three-dimensional point cloud data of the material surface, and one of the three-dimensional point cloud data is used as the center point of the cube.
[0008] Based on the three-dimensional point cloud data of the material surface within each cube, the equivalent material surface height of each cube is determined; whereby the equivalent material surface height is used to measure the volume of slag contained in the cube.
[0009] The grab bucket's operating position is determined based on the equivalent material surface height of each cube.

[0043] To provide a clearer explanation of the above-mentioned method for analyzing the material level in the slag flushing pool, each step will be explained in detail below.
[0044] Figure 2 This is a specific example diagram of the slag flushing pool material level height analysis method according to an embodiment of the present invention.
[0045] In one embodiment of the present invention, reference is made to Figure 2 The detailed process for obtaining the 3D point cloud data of the slag flushing pool surface is as follows:
[0046] Step 201: Use lidar to scan the surface of the slag flushing pool and obtain point cloud polar coordinate data of the slag flushing pool surface;
[0047] Step 202: Perform coordinate transformation on the polar coordinate data of the point cloud of the slag flushing pool material surface to obtain the three-dimensional point cloud data of the slag flushing pool material surface in the world coordinate system.
[0048] Figure 3 This is a specific example diagram of the slag flushing pool material level height analysis method according to an embodiment of the present invention.
[0049] In one embodiment of the present invention, reference is made to Figure 3 The data acquisition device needs to be installed above the slag flushing pool, and its scanning range needs to be able to completely cover the slag flushing pool. The data acquisition device is used to obtain three-dimensional information of the slag flushing pool material surface within its scanning range. The data acquisition device includes a lidar and a turntable.
[0050] In one embodiment of the present invention, based on the Time-of-Flight (TOF) principle, a data acquisition device is used to scan the slag flushing pool. This data acquisition device is a combination of a lidar and a turntable. Three-dimensional point cloud data of the slag surface in the flushing pool is obtained. When the lidar is working, it continuously acquires two-dimensional data of the scanned section. The lidar is fixed to the shaft connector of the turntable, and the controller controls the turntable to rotate. The lidar moves with the turntable, simultaneously acquiring slag data within the scanning range, thereby achieving the acquisition of three-dimensional point cloud data of the slag surface. The TOF principle involves continuously sending light pulses to a target, receiving the light pulses returning from the object, and measuring the time of flight (round trip) of the light pulses to determine the distance to the target.
[0051] In practice, the lidar can obtain the point cloud polar coordinate data of the object being measured based on the Time-of-Flight (TOF) principle, and then convert the polar coordinate data into the world coordinate system using the following formula:
[0052] x=dsinα
[0053] y = dcosαcosβ
[0054] z=dcosαsinβ
[0055] Where x is the x-direction value in the world coordinate system; y is the y-direction value in the world coordinate system; z is the z-direction value in the world coordinate system; d is the distance value measured by the lidar according to the TOF method; α is the angle between the plane formed by the single-pulse laser and the lidar's vertical ground scan; β is the angle between the projection of the single-pulse laser onto the plane formed by the lidar's vertical ground scan and the horizontal plane.
[0056] In the above embodiments, various parameters of the turntable and lidar can be set during use to control the 3D point cloud data density, scanning range, and scanning time. The scanned data can be stored in the data acquisition device, and the data stored in the data acquisition device can be sent and the register cleared via a communication device.
[0057] Figure 4 This is a specific example diagram of the slag flushing pool material level height analysis method according to an embodiment of the present invention.
[0058] In one embodiment of the present invention, the grabbing range of the grab bucket within the slag flushing tank is determined based on the size parameters of the slag flushing tank and the size parameters of the grab bucket when fully extended; the size parameters of the grab bucket when fully extended are referenced. Figure 4 When the grab bucket is fully open, its length is Lcrab, its width is Zcrab, and its height is Hcrab. That is, the grab bucket can grab a cubic piece of slag with a length of Lcrab, a width of Zcrab, and a height of Hcrab.

[0080] In one embodiment of the present invention, determining the grab bucket operating position based on the equivalent material surface height of each cube includes: determining the functional relationship between the equivalent material surface height of the cube and the length and width coordinates of the cube's center point based on the length coordinates and width coordinates of the center point of each cube and the equivalent material surface height of each cube; and determining the grab bucket operating position based on the functional relationship between the equivalent material surface height of the cube and the length and width coordinates of the cube's center point.
[0081] In practice, each three-dimensional point cloud data point along the length of the slag-flushing pool material surface within the grab range of the grab bucket is taken as the center of a cube. Based on the three-dimensional point cloud data of the material surface within each cube, the equivalent material surface height of each cube is determined. Then, the functional relationship between the equivalent material surface height of the cube and the length coordinate of the cube's center point can be further determined. Similarly, each three-dimensional point cloud data point along the width of the slag-flushing pool material surface within the grab range of the grab bucket is taken as the center of a cube. Based on the three-dimensional point cloud data of the material surface within each cube, the equivalent material surface height of each cube is determined. Then, the functional relationship between the equivalent material surface height of the cube and the width coordinate of the cube's center point can be further determined.
[0082] Figure 8 This is a specific example diagram of the slag flushing pool material level height analysis method according to an embodiment of the present invention.
[0083] In one embodiment of the present invention, reference is made to Figure 8 In the slag material surface of the slag flushing pool, the functional relationship between the equivalent material surface height of the cube and the length coordinate of the cube's center point is Y = f(X). Based on the functional relationship between the equivalent material surface height of the cube and the length coordinate of the cube's center point, the grab bucket operation position is determined to be Pcrab, which is the center position of the cube with the largest equivalent material surface height, and the highest point of the slag material surface is Ptop.
[0084] Figure 9 This is a specific example diagram of the slag flushing pool material level height analysis method according to an embodiment of the present invention.
[0085] In another embodiment of the present invention, reference is made to Figure 9Using lidar to scan the material surface, three-dimensional point cloud data is obtained. Based on the grab bucket width, the material surface is divided into N sub-material surfaces along the width direction of the slag flushing pool. Each sub-material surface has the same width direction coordinates. N sub-material surfaces are divided according to each three-dimensional point cloud data point along the width direction. The nth sub-material surface is selected, and its width direction coordinates are determined. Based on the width direction coordinates of the nth sub-material surface, M cubes are determined along the length direction of the nth sub-material surface according to the grab bucket length. Cubes are selected from the starting position, and three-dimensional point cloud data within the range of the m-th cube are collected, totaling G three-dimensional point cloud data points. The center of the cube is the three-dimensional point cloud data point. The average material surface height of the G three-dimensional point cloud data points is calculated. Based on the cube center point and the average material surface height, the initial fitting point coordinates of the m-th cube are determined. The distances between the G three-dimensional point cloud data points and the initial fitting point are calculated, and the average distance and sum are further calculated. For each 3D point cloud data and height correction coefficient, the equivalent height of the current cube, i.e., the equivalent height of the m-th cube, is determined based on the 3D point cloud data and height correction coefficient within the cube's range. It is then determined whether the equivalent height calculation for the M cubes along the length direction of the n-th sub-material surface has been completed. If not, the calculation for the next cube along the same length direction, i.e., the length direction of the n-th sub-material surface, needs to be performed. Here, the center of each cube can be determined using the 3D point cloud data along the center line of the sub-material surface's length direction, and the grab's dimensions can be used as the cube's dimensions. If the equivalent height calculation for the M cubes along the length direction of the n-th sub-material surface has been completed, it is determined whether the calculation for the N sub-material surfaces has been completed. If not, the calculation for the next sub-material surface needs to be performed, determining the M cubes along the length direction of the next sub-material surface, until the calculation for the N sub-material surfaces is completed, thus completing the height analysis.
